It seems that Texas holdem is more of a card game of ability instead of fortune. This is how certain pros can remain at the top of tournaments constantly.

The key to any poker game is keeping that proper poker look. Awesome poker players understand to watch their competitor’s faces and actions to observe how you react when you review your cards, or when you observe other individuals playing their hands. If you get all high-strung or mad when you analyze your cards then another more experienced player(s) will work off of that.

The second smartest action you can attempt when competing in Texas holdem is to only play the good hands. Never throw away your cash attempting to bluff competitors when you have zilch, or attempting to make large wagers to drive players off. Don’t make the typical flaw of becoming anxious. This leads to apathy and squanders your $$$$.

Even the best squander huge money at times so when this happens to you, you’ve to recover from the defeat as quickly as you are able to. Take a rest, stroll around, even take a break for a couple of hands. Just make certain you have recovered before you get back into a match.

One of the greatest things you can do when playing poker is figuring out how to understand your opponents. You may see a few players attempting to understand you but remain at peace. Once you’ve figured out how to coordinate both your feelings and the ability to read other adversaries you’ll see your success rate get better.

If you do not utilize capable poker policy the game is considerably harder to come away with a win as you depend too much on fortune. If you are wanting to make some actual money at the table then compete more regularly and pay attention to the match. The more experienced you are the more effective of a player you will be.
